铝表面自组装分子及缓蚀剂复合膜的制备及耐蚀性能

摘    要:在铝表面组装一层仅数分子厚的双-3-(三乙氧基)硅丙基]四硫化物(BTESPT)偶联剂膜后,将其浸入某分子中含有长链烷基的有机酸酯缓蚀剂A溶液中,取出吹干后在一定条件下固化形成致密疏水的复合膜。通过盐雾试验、极化曲线和交流阻抗评价了复合膜的耐蚀性能,结果表明复合膜固化后膜层结构致密具有良好疏水性,对铝合金具有很好的防护作用,且膜中不含重金属和氟化物对环境友好。

PREPARATION AND CORROSION RESISTANCE OF COMPLEX FILM COMPOSED OF SELF-ADJUSTING MOLECULE AND CORROSION INHIBITOR ON ALUMINUM SURFACE

Abstract:After assembling BTESPT of molecule's thickness on the surface,the Aluminum sheet was immerged in a solution with long line alkyl organic acid ester corrosion inhibitor.Then the sheet was taken out of the solution,then dried and cured in a condition to form compact hydrophobe complex film.The corrosion resistant of the film was examined by using salt-spray test,polarization curves and AC impedance.The complex film had excellent corrosion resistant for aluminum and did not contain heavy metal and fluorin element.
